Każdego roku w Studium Języka Polskiego dla Cudzoziemców przy Uniwersytecie Łódzkim wielu młodych ludzi z całego świata rozpoczyna naukę języka polskiego. W zależności od swoich wcześniejszych doświadczeń glottodydaktycznych w zakresie nauki tego języka, uczęszczają na zajęcia odbywające się w Studium przez miesiąc w ramach tak zwanej sesji orientacyjnej, w trakcie której ocenie poddawane są ich umiejętności językowe lub przez cały rok akademicki (od października do czerwca). Rokrocznie w gronie obcojęzycznych studentów Studium przebywa kilku studentów z Bułgarii - wybrane typy błędów, popełniane przez nich w języku polskim, stanowią przedmiot opisu niniejszego artykułu.

The aim of the paper is to use a modified method of partial differences with the Taylor series to explain the impact of various factors on the change of EVA. The assumption was that every company is in a different financial condition, so the impact of various factors on the EVA change is different. In case of studied company, in subsequent three years, different influences of various factors are observed, both of individual and combined factors as well. It means that for each company and each year managers should consider the factors that influence the EVA change.

The article describes the festival of Kurban-Bayram, celebrated between 7th and 10th December 2008 in a town of Vyrbica in the north-east Bulgaria. The region is inhabited by a several ethnic groups such as: Bulgarians, Turks, two communities of Romanies, and others, where the Christianity and Islam are not considered as an ethnic criterion. Kurban, being a ritual during which a sacrifice of a domestic horned animal is made, was celebrated there with a few locally and ethnically conditioned variations. The article also discusses the process of ethnological research and the way of exploring the territory, as experienced by its authoresses working in this specific environment. Both formed a 'tandem', complementing each other. In this arrangement, one of them played a part of a 'guide' of the other, while the other one was a 'debutante', knowing neither the language nor the area. For both authoresses, however, the universal language, which allowed them to penetrate and approach these unknown and untamed regions, was the language of photography.
